Relevance is the primary qualitative characteristic that makes accounting information capable of influencing user decisions.
Accounting information possesses relevance when it is capable of making a difference in the decisions made by users. It achieves this by helping users evaluate past, present, or future events (predictive value) or confirming/correcting previous expectations (confirmatory value).

Distinguish between fundamental and enhancing qualitative characteristics.
Fundamental characteristics are Relevance and Faithful Representation. Enhancing characteristics are Comparability, Verifiability, Timeliness, and Understandability.
Relevance directly addresses decision-usefulness through predictive and confirmatory value.
